Answer:
2H₂O₂ → 2H₂O + O₂
Explanation:
Chemical equation:
H₂O₂ → H₂O + O₂
Balanced chemical equation:
2H₂O₂ → 2H₂O + O₂
Two mole of hydrogen peroxide split to gives two mole of water and one mole of oxygen.
